Ilha do Governador, or 'Governor's Island', is an important area of the North Zone of Rio de Janeiro, containing a number of well known districts with a rich cultural heritage - Portuguesa is one of these neighborhoods, located just east of the Aeroporto Internacional Tom Jobim, or 'Tom Jobim International Airport', and lapped to the north by the waters of the guanabara bay.

It is one of the wealthier and peaceful residential areas of the island, which shares borders with the districts of moneró and jardim carioca to the east, jardim guanabara to the south, and galeão to the west.

For centuries after the arrival of the Portuguese the region was almost entirely covered by woodland. In the early 20th century it was home to a dynamite storage facility, which exploded with horrifying force in 1933. Indeed, it is said that the iron gates in Rio's city center shook from the blast. arrow-back      arrow-forward
